# Sweco Strengthens Its Footprint with Acquisition of Civil Engineering Consultancy

In a strategic move to enhance its global service offerings, Sweco, a leading engineering consultancy firm, has announced the acquisition of Civil Engineering Consultancy. While the financial details of the transaction remain undisclosed, the acquisition marks a significant step for both companies in the evolving infrastructure landscape.

Founded in Croatia, Civil Engineering Consultancy has built a strong reputation over the past two decades, offering a comprehensive suite of services in planning, design, and project management for public and private clients. With extensive experience across Europe and the Middle East, their team has successfully managed numerous projects from feasibility studies to contractor handover, positioning them as a regional expert in engineering consultancy.

Sweco, headquartered in Sweden, has established itself as a prominent player in the European engineering consultancy market, specializing in architecture, civil engineering, and environmental services. With a commitment to sustainability and innovation, Sweco's acquisition of Civil Engineering Consultancy is expected to bolster its capabilities in delivering integrated solutions that meet the growing demands of infrastructure development.

The strategic rationale behind this acquisition lies in the complementary strengths of both firms. Sweco can leverage Civil Engineering Consultancy’s local expertise to expand its market reach in Southeast Europe, particularly as regional infrastructure investments increase following Croatia’s EU accession. This partnership aims to enhance project delivery efficiency and innovation, enabling both companies to better serve clients in an increasingly competitive landscape.

The acquisition could have broader implications for the industry as well. As engineering consultancies face pressures to deliver projects more efficiently amid rising costs, this consolidation may signal a trend toward larger, more integrated firms that can provide end-to-end solutions. The move could also inspire other firms to seek similar partnerships to remain competitive, potentially leading to further industry consolidation.
